Humboldt's hog-nosed skunk (Conepatus humboldtii), illustration. Also known as the Patagonian hog-nosed skunk, this is a type of hog-nosed skunk indigenous to the open grassy areas in the Patagonian regions of Argentina and Chile. It belongs to the order Carnivora and the family Mephitidae. From the book 'Voyage dans l'Amerique Meridionale' (Journey to South America: (Brazil, the eastern republic of Uruguay, the Argentine Republic, Patagonia, the republic of Chile, the republic of Bolivia, the republic of Peru), executed during the years 1826-1833), 4th volume, Part 3, by Alcide Dessalines d'Orbigny (1802-1857). Publication date: 1835-1847.
